Recommended update for pmix

Announcement ID: SUSE-RU-2023:1741-1
Rating: important
References:
Affected Products:
  • HPC Module 15-SP4
  • openSUSE Leap 15.3
  • openSUSE Leap 15.4
  • SUSE Linux Enterprise High Performance Computing 15 SP3
  • SUSE Linux Enterprise High Performance Computing 15 SP4
  • SUSE Linux Enterprise High Performance Computing ESPOS 15 SP3
  • SUSE Linux Enterprise High Performance Computing LTSS 15 SP3

An update that has two fixes can now be installed.

Description:

This update for pmix fixes the following issues:

  • Move the requirement for pmix-runtime-config to libpmix2 and make it version-independent (bsc#1209473)
  • Fix for Slurm requiring pmix-devel (bsc#1209260)
  • New subpackages:
  • pmix-munge-plugin: Includes the psec munge plugin, to avoid dependency issues with the main package
  • pmix-test: Test package that includes Pmix to give users the opportunity to test their setup. Test files are installed in /usr/lib/pmix/tests to avoid conflicts on 32 bits systems

Patch Instructions:

To install this SUSE update use the SUSE recommended installation methods like YaST online_update or "zypper patch".
Alternatively you can run the command listed for your product:

  • openSUSE Leap 15.3
    zypper in -t patch SUSE-2023-1741=1
  • openSUSE Leap 15.4
    zypper in -t patch openSUSE-SLE-15.4-2023-1741=1
  • HPC Module 15-SP4
    zypper in -t patch SUSE-SLE-Module-HPC-15-SP4-2023-1741=1
  • SUSE Linux Enterprise High Performance Computing ESPOS 15 SP3
    zypper in -t patch SUSE-SLE-Product-HPC-15-SP3-ESPOS-2023-1741=1
  • SUSE Linux Enterprise High Performance Computing LTSS 15 SP3
    zypper in -t patch SUSE-SLE-Product-HPC-15-SP3-LTSS-2023-1741=1

Package List:

  • openSUSE Leap 15.3 (aarch64 ppc64le s390x x86_64 i586)
    • libmca_common_dstore1-debuginfo-3.2.3-150300.3.5.1
    • pmix-3.2.3-150300.3.5.1
    • pmix-plugins-debuginfo-3.2.3-150300.3.5.1
    • pmix-plugins-3.2.3-150300.3.5.1
    • pmix-test-3.2.3-150300.3.5.1
    • pmix-devel-3.2.3-150300.3.5.1
    • pmix-plugin-munge-3.2.3-150300.3.5.1
    • pmix-debugsource-3.2.3-150300.3.5.1
    • libpmix2-3.2.3-150300.3.5.1
    • libmca_common_dstore1-3.2.3-150300.3.5.1
    • pmix-plugin-munge-debuginfo-3.2.3-150300.3.5.1
    • libpmix2-debuginfo-3.2.3-150300.3.5.1
    • pmix-debuginfo-3.2.3-150300.3.5.1
    • pmix-test-debuginfo-3.2.3-150300.3.5.1
  • openSUSE Leap 15.3 (noarch)
    • pmix-mca-params-3.2.3-150300.3.5.1
    • pmix-headers-3.2.3-150300.3.5.1
  • openSUSE Leap 15.4 (aarch64 ppc64le s390x x86_64)
    • libmca_common_dstore1-debuginfo-3.2.3-150300.3.5.1
    • pmix-3.2.3-150300.3.5.1
    • pmix-plugins-debuginfo-3.2.3-150300.3.5.1
    • pmix-plugins-3.2.3-150300.3.5.1
    • pmix-test-3.2.3-150300.3.5.1
    • pmix-devel-3.2.3-150300.3.5.1
    • pmix-plugin-munge-3.2.3-150300.3.5.1
    • pmix-debugsource-3.2.3-150300.3.5.1
    • libpmix2-3.2.3-150300.3.5.1
    • libmca_common_dstore1-3.2.3-150300.3.5.1
    • pmix-plugin-munge-debuginfo-3.2.3-150300.3.5.1
    • libpmix2-debuginfo-3.2.3-150300.3.5.1
    • pmix-debuginfo-3.2.3-150300.3.5.1
    • pmix-test-debuginfo-3.2.3-150300.3.5.1
  • openSUSE Leap 15.4 (noarch)
    • pmix-mca-params-3.2.3-150300.3.5.1
    • pmix-headers-3.2.3-150300.3.5.1
  • HPC Module 15-SP4 (aarch64 x86_64)
    • libmca_common_dstore1-debuginfo-3.2.3-150300.3.5.1
    • pmix-3.2.3-150300.3.5.1
    • pmix-plugins-debuginfo-3.2.3-150300.3.5.1
    • pmix-plugins-3.2.3-150300.3.5.1
    • pmix-test-3.2.3-150300.3.5.1
    • pmix-plugin-munge-3.2.3-150300.3.5.1
    • pmix-debugsource-3.2.3-150300.3.5.1
    • libpmix2-3.2.3-150300.3.5.1
    • libmca_common_dstore1-3.2.3-150300.3.5.1
    • pmix-plugin-munge-debuginfo-3.2.3-150300.3.5.1
    • libpmix2-debuginfo-3.2.3-150300.3.5.1
    • pmix-debuginfo-3.2.3-150300.3.5.1
    • pmix-test-debuginfo-3.2.3-150300.3.5.1
  • HPC Module 15-SP4 (noarch)
    • pmix-mca-params-3.2.3-150300.3.5.1
    • pmix-headers-3.2.3-150300.3.5.1
  • HPC Module 15-SP4 (x86_64)
    • pmix-devel-3.2.3-150300.3.5.1
  • SUSE Linux Enterprise High Performance Computing ESPOS 15 SP3 (aarch64 x86_64)
    • libmca_common_dstore1-debuginfo-3.2.3-150300.3.5.1
    • pmix-3.2.3-150300.3.5.1
    • pmix-plugins-debuginfo-3.2.3-150300.3.5.1
    • pmix-plugins-3.2.3-150300.3.5.1
    • pmix-test-3.2.3-150300.3.5.1
    • pmix-plugin-munge-3.2.3-150300.3.5.1
    • pmix-debugsource-3.2.3-150300.3.5.1
    • libpmix2-3.2.3-150300.3.5.1
    • libmca_common_dstore1-3.2.3-150300.3.5.1
    • pmix-plugin-munge-debuginfo-3.2.3-150300.3.5.1
    • libpmix2-debuginfo-3.2.3-150300.3.5.1
    • pmix-debuginfo-3.2.3-150300.3.5.1
    • pmix-test-debuginfo-3.2.3-150300.3.5.1
  • SUSE Linux Enterprise High Performance Computing ESPOS 15 SP3 (noarch)
    • pmix-mca-params-3.2.3-150300.3.5.1
    • pmix-headers-3.2.3-150300.3.5.1
  • SUSE Linux Enterprise High Performance Computing ESPOS 15 SP3 (x86_64)
    • pmix-devel-3.2.3-150300.3.5.1
  • SUSE Linux Enterprise High Performance Computing LTSS 15 SP3 (aarch64 x86_64)
    • libmca_common_dstore1-debuginfo-3.2.3-150300.3.5.1
    • pmix-3.2.3-150300.3.5.1
    • pmix-plugins-debuginfo-3.2.3-150300.3.5.1
    • pmix-plugins-3.2.3-150300.3.5.1
    • pmix-test-3.2.3-150300.3.5.1
    • pmix-plugin-munge-3.2.3-150300.3.5.1
    • pmix-debugsource-3.2.3-150300.3.5.1
    • libpmix2-3.2.3-150300.3.5.1
    • libmca_common_dstore1-3.2.3-150300.3.5.1
    • pmix-plugin-munge-debuginfo-3.2.3-150300.3.5.1
    • libpmix2-debuginfo-3.2.3-150300.3.5.1
    • pmix-debuginfo-3.2.3-150300.3.5.1
    • pmix-test-debuginfo-3.2.3-150300.3.5.1
  • SUSE Linux Enterprise High Performance Computing LTSS 15 SP3 (noarch)
    • pmix-mca-params-3.2.3-150300.3.5.1
    • pmix-headers-3.2.3-150300.3.5.1
  • SUSE Linux Enterprise High Performance Computing LTSS 15 SP3 (x86_64)
    • pmix-devel-3.2.3-150300.3.5.1

References: